Analysis

Finland recorded 18.1% for median of the housing cost burden distribution by degree of in 2025. That is the highest value across all 22 years on record.

That represents a change of up 2.8% on the previous year and up 26.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, median of the housing cost burden distribution by degree of in Finland peaked at 18.1% in 2025 and was at its lowest, 13.6%, in 2019.

That places Finland 11th out of 45 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 22 years of available data.

Median of the housing cost burden distribution by degree of in Finland, year by year

Annual values for Median of the housing cost burden distribution by degree of urbanisation in Finland, 2004 to 2025.
Year Percentage Change
2004 14.6%
2005 14.1% -3.4%
2006 14.8% +5.0%
2007 14.9% +0.7%
2008 15.8% +6.0%
2009 16.7% +5.7%
2010 15.1% -9.6%
2011 14.3% -5.3%
2012 15.0% +4.9%
2013 14.9% -0.7%
2014 14.3% -4.0%
2015 14.3% +0.0%
2016 14.4% +0.7%
2017 14.4% +0.0%
2018 14.0% -2.8%
2019 13.6% -2.9%
2020 13.9% +2.2%
2021 13.8% -0.7%
2022 15.1% +9.4%
2023 15.4% +2.0%
2024 17.6% +14.3%
2025 18.1% +2.8%
